Convicted Felon Arrested for Weapon Possession

Weapon and ammunition confiscated

NDIO — A 25-year-old resident of Indio and a documented criminal street gang member, was placed under arrest for being a convicted felon in possession of a firearm and ammunition.

Ramiro Araujo was ultimately transported to the John Benoit Detention Center in Indio.

On Friday, April 5, 2024, at 3:10 p.m., members of the Coachella Valley Violent Crime Gang Task Force (GTF) served a weapons-related search warrant in the 46500 block of Monroe Street, Indio. During the service of the search warrant, GTF members located a 9mm handgun, two large-capacity magazines, a micro conversion kit, also known as a pistol brace, and ammunition inside the residence, according to Sgt. Cameron James.

The Coachella Valley Violent Crime Gang Task Force is a multi-agency task force and is committed to creating safe and secure neighborhoods free of violent crime and gang activity.
